Arizona strengthens its secondary by adding a pair of transfer defensive backs

As first reported by Chris Hummer of CBS Sports, Arizona has added former Nebraska defensive back Malcolm Hertzog Jr. Hertzog provides Arizona adds experience and production with Hertzog. Former Northern Colorado safety Cam Chapa also committed to Arizona on Saturday.

Hartzog suffered a groin/adductor (core muscle) injury that led to season-ending surgery. In three full seasons at Nebraska, plus the two games in 2025, Hartzog Jr. had 108 tackles, 4.5 tackles for loss, 13 pass breakups, eight interceptions and 21.0 passes defended. Hartzog Jr. should compete to be a starting safety for Arizona in 2026.
